Richardson Mill Creek
Richardson Mill Creek is a stream in Newton, Mississippi. Richardson Mill Creek is situated nearby to the village Newton, as well as near the hamlet Cedar Grove.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Newton is a city in Newton County, Mississippi. The population was 3,195 in the 2020 census. The populations is about 70 percent African American.
